Detectives investigating shooting on October Place

On April 14, shortly after 4 p.m., officers responded to the 3000 block of October Place in Waldorf for the report of a shooting. Upon arrival, officers located an adult male with multiple gunshot wounds. The victim was transported to a hospital office where he is being treated for serious injuries. Patrol officers arrest juveniles in assault and strong-armed robbery case

On April 13, at approximately 5 p.m., patrol officers responded to a report of a large fight involving juveniles in the area of 3515 Promenade Place in Waldorf. Upon arrival, officers located a juvenile victim suffering from a broken nose who reported being assaulted by multiple individuals who then stole his shoes. Student in possession of knife on school grounds

On April 9 at 2 p.m., school administrators and a school resource officer at Benjamin Stoddert Middle School were made aware of a student who was in possession of a knife hidden in their clothing. Charles County Sheriff’s corrections officer indicted and charged with sexual contact with an incarcerated individual  

Charles County, MD... On March 28, 2025, a Charles County Grand Jury indicted Kolbey Cooper, age 22, a Charles County corrections officer, with two counts of sexual contact with an incarcerated individual, two counts of 4th-degree sex offense, and delivering contraband (an e-cigarette) to a person detained in a place of confinement. UPDATE: Richard Wilson, Jr., Age 86, Located Deceased near Mariner Drive in Fort Washington, MD

Charles County, MD…On March 27, at approximately 2 p.m., Charles County Sheriff’s detectives were notified by the Prince George’s County Police Department that Richard Wilson, Jr., age 86, who had been reported missing from his Waldorf home on January 25, was found deceased in the water near Mariner Drive in Fort Washington, MD. Charles County Sheriff’s Office Suspends Officer Following Arrest

On March 20, the County Sheriff’s Office suspended Officer David Moats, a 1 ½-year veteran of the agency, after he was arrested and charged with second-degree assault involving a relative earlier on March 20 in St. Mary’s County, MD.
